Abstract
A new series of cobalt(II) complexes with metoclopramide (MCP) ligand have been prepared. The prepared Co(II)–MCP complexes were characterized for various analytical techniques. Conductivity and elemental analysis of complexes have been measured. The thermal stability and degradation kinetics have been measured using thermogravimetric analyser. Kinetic parameter was obtained for each stage of thermal degradation for Co(II)–MCP complexes using Horowitz–Metzger, Coats–Redfern and Broido’s methods. The activation energy (Ea) of the complexes for the thermal degradation process lie in the range 31–168, 23–161 and 33–170 kJ mol−1 for Horowitz–Metzger, Coats–Redfern and Broido’s methods, respectively.
